Patch Manager Plus is an all round solution for your enterprise that enables you to manage and distribute patches to endpoints across the IT network. These endpoints consist of laptops, servers and workstations. Regularly updating applications across these systems, heightens the over all security...

Recommended for
This solution is recommended for IT administrators and organizations that require a reliable way to manage the patching of multiple systems and applications, especially those with diverse IT environments or limited resources to dedicate to manual patch management. It’s particularly suitable for medium to large enterprises looking to enhance their security posture and compliance efforts.
